** The home security market in Coquille, Oregon, is characteristic of a smaller, rural community. There are no major security companies headquartered within the city limits itself. Instead, the market is efficiently served by established providers located in the neighboring and more populous Coos Bay/North Bend area, approximately a 15-20 minute drive away. **Competition Level:** Moderate. While the number of physical storefronts is limited, competition is robust among the regional and national providers serving the area. Customers have a clear choice between large, tech-forward brands (Vivint), nationally monitored systems with local dealers (ADT via Safe Street), and dedicated local contractors (All Secure Security). **Average Quality:** The quality of service is generally high. The local and regional companies pride themselves on personalized customer service and reliability, while the national providers offer cutting-edge technology and extensive monitoring networks. All reputable providers are expected to be licensed by the Oregon Construction Contractors Board (CCB). **Typical Pricing:** * **Installation:** Can range from $0 with specific contracts to $500-$1,500+ for more complex, custom systems with multiple cameras and access controls. * **Monthly Monitoring:** Typically falls between **$35 - $65 per month**. Basic alarm monitoring is at the lower end, while packages that include smart home automation, video storage, and interactive services are at the higher end. * **Equipment:** Often bundled into a financed package or included with a long-term monitoring contract.

In Coquille, a basic professionally installed system typically starts around $200-$500 for equipment and installation, with monthly monitoring fees ranging from $30 to $60. Local factors like the need for weather-resistant equipment due to our coastal Oregon rain and fog, and potentially longer technician travel times to more rural properties in the Coquille Valley, can sometimes add to the initial cost. It's wise to get quotes from several providers to compare.
Coquille's wet climate means you should prioritize systems with outdoor cameras and sensors rated for outdoor use (look for IP65 or higher weatherproof ratings) to prevent moisture damage. Given that winter storms can cause power outages, a system with a reliable cellular backup and a long-lasting battery is crucial to ensure continuous protection even when the power is down.
The City of Coquille does not generally require a permit for a standard homeowner-installed security system. However, if your system includes an audible alarm, you should register it with the Coquille Police Department to avoid potential fines for excessive false alarms. For systems that require significant electrical work or structural modification, checking with the Coquille Community Development Department is recommended.
A reputable local provider often has faster response times for service and installation, and they have specific knowledge of common security concerns in our area. They may also offer more personalized service. However, national companies might have more extensive technology options. Always check for proper Oregon licensing, read local reviews, and ask for local references to gauge reliability.
For rural properties on the outskirts of Coquille, consider perimeter sensors, motion-activated lighting, and cellular-based systems due to potentially unreliable landlines. For in-town homes, door/window sensors, security cameras covering porches, and smart doorbells are highly effective. For all properties, given local wildlife, ensure your motion sensors can be adjusted to avoid false triggers from deer or other animals.
